Engineering a Sustainable Future: Technology Solutions for a Greener Planet

To mitigate the impacts of climate change and foster a vibrant future, technological innovations are essential. Renewable energy sources, such as solar, wind, and hydro, offer sustainable alternatives to fossil fuels. Smart grids can optimize energy distribution, reducing waste and boosting efficiency. In agriculture, precision farming techniques leverage technology to decrease resource consumption while enhancing yields. Furthermore, advancements in transportation, such as electric vehicles and autonomous driving systems, can significantly decrease carbon emissions.
